The Dual Engine of Change: AI as the Brain, Biologicals as the Body
The current transformation is powered by a synergistic duo. Artificial Intelligence functions as the analytical and predictive brain, processing data from sensors, satellites, and machinery to generate insights. Biological products—including biopesticides, biofertilizers, and biostimulants—constitute the targeted, sustainable body of intervention tools. Their integration creates a closed-loop system of measurement and management.
The underlying economic logic is compelling. Traditional agriculture manages risk and yield through prophylactic, blanket applications of chemical inputs, a model susceptible to price volatility and regulatory change. The AI-biological model seeks to replace this with precise, prescription-based applications. AI identifies when and where intervention is needed, and biologicals provide the what, enabling targeted actions that reduce input volumes, lower cost volatility, and mitigate environmental impact. This transition aligns with broader economic analyses of precision agriculture's potential to improve margin resilience (Source 1: [McKinsey & Company Agtech Analysis]).
The Hidden Entry Point: Reshaping the Agricultural Supply Chain from the Ground Up
The convergence of AI and biologicals is restructuring the agricultural value chain from its foundation. Input manufacturers and distributors face a fundamental shift: value creation is migrating from selling volume of chemicals to providing data-integrated biological solutions and the analytics platforms that optimize them. The role of the agronomist is transforming from a product recommender to an interpreter of complex data streams and system health.
This points toward the "servitization" of farming. Instead of discrete purchases, future models may involve subscription-based platforms where farmers pay for outcomes—such as guaranteed soil health metrics or pest pressure management—delivered via a combination of AI-driven monitoring and biological product applications. This evolution creates new power dynamics. Farm-level data autonomy becomes a critical asset, yet dependency on proprietary, integrated tech-biological platforms presents a countervailing force of potential vendor lock-in.

Conclusion: The New Core Competency and Neutral Market Forecast
The synthesis of Artificial Intelligence and biological products is emerging as the new core competency for modern agribusiness. It represents a holistic framework where biologicals provide the mechanistic tools for intervention and AI provides the contextual intelligence for deployment.
Neutral market predictions based on this trajectory include:
- Accelerated Consolidation: Expect further mergers and partnerships between biological product firms and agricultural data/analytics companies.
- Business Model Proliferation: Subscription and outcome-based service models will gain traction alongside traditional product sales, particularly in high-value specialty crops and large-scale row crop operations.
- Regulatory Evolution: Regulatory frameworks will face pressure to adapt to faster innovation cycles for biological products and to establish standards for agricultural data ownership, privacy, and interoperability.
- Divergence in Adoption: Adoption rates will create a widening gap between early-adoptering, tech-integrated farms and those unable to access or implement these complex systems, potentially impacting regional competitiveness.
